The Historical Evolution of Classic Casinos

The story of the casino, as we know it today, traces its roots back to Venice, Italy, in the 17th century, with the opening of the Ridotto, the first public gambling house. Initially intended to provide controlled gambling during carnival season, the Ridotto quickly gained notoriety and served as a model for casinos established across Europe. These early establishments were largely frequented by the aristocracy and elite, establishing the association between casinos and a sense of luxury. Throughout the 19th century, casinos flourished, particularly in Monte Carlo, which became synonymous with high-stakes gambling and opulent elegance. The late 19th and early 20th centuries saw the rise of casinos in the United States, with locations like Las Vegas transforming into global entertainment hubs, building upon the foundation laid by their European predecessors.

The development of casino games themselves also contributed to their historical evolution. Games like roulette and blackjack, originating in France and Europe, were gradually refined and popularized, becoming staples of casino floors worldwide. The introduction of slot machines in the late 19th century marked a significant turning point, making gambling accessible to a wider audience increasing their appeal.

The Golden Age of Las Vegas

The mid-20th century witnessed the birth of the “Golden Age” of Las Vegas. Fueled by post-war economic prosperity and a loosening of gambling regulations, Las Vegas transformed from a small desert town into a dazzling entertainment capital. Iconic casinos, such as the Flamingo and the Sahara, emerged, each vying to offer the most luxurious accommodations and exciting gaming experiences. This era saw the arrival of legendary performers, drawing in crowds from across the globe. The Rat Pack, with performers like Frank Sinatra and Dean Martin, became synonymous with the Las Vegas lifestyle. The emphasis on showmanship and spectacle solidifed the city’s reputation as a premier destination for both gambling and entertainment.

This period also saw the development of casino resort models, integrating hotels, restaurants, nightclubs, and shopping centers around the central casino. This created a destination experience unlike any other, encouraging visitors extending their stays and increasing casino revenue. The rise of mass tourism also played a significant role, making Las Vegas accessible to a broader demographic, not just the high rollers.

European Casino Traditions

While Las Vegas was developing its distinctive, large-scale resort model, European casinos maintained a more traditional, understated elegance. Monte Carlo continued to be a hub for high-stakes gambling, attracting an international clientele. Casinos in London, Baden-Baden, and other European cities emphasized discretion and a refined atmosphere. These European casinos often catered to a more sophisticated clientele, valuing privacy and personalized service. The casino games offered were also reflective of regional preferences, with a strong focus on table games like roulette and baccarat. A key distinction revolved around the dress code and overall formality, which remained significantly higher than in the increasingly casual atmosphere of Las Vegas.

European casinos have also played a pivotal role in refining casino operations and security measures. Their established history and strict regulatory frameworks contributed to innovations in game integrity and player protection, setting standards for the industry as a whole. Furthermore, the architecture and interior design of many European casinos are historical masterpieces, often incorporating stunning artwork and opulent decoration.

Understanding Roulette Variants

Roulette, while seemingly simple in concept, has a variety of variants, each offering slightly different rules and odds. The most common versions include European Roulette, American Roulette, and French Roulette. European Roulette features a single zero, giving players better odds compared to American Roulette, which has both a zero and a double zero. French Roulette often incorporates the “La Partage” rule, which refunds players half their bet if the ball lands on zero— further improving the player’s chances. Each variation influences the gameplay experience and potential return to players, so understanding the differences is important for strategic players. The design of the roulette wheel and table layout are also consistent elements, contributing to the visual recognition of the game.

The history of roulette itself is fascinating, with its origins tracing back to the attempts of Blaise Pascal to create a perpetual motion machine. Therefore, the game’s evolution serves as an interesting example of how scientific endeavors can unintentionally lead to popular forms of entertainment. Roulette’s enduring appeal lies in its combination of chance, strategy, and the thrill of watching the wheel spin.

The Strategy Behind Blackjack

Blackjack is notable for being a casino game where player skill can significantly impact the odds. Unlike games based solely on chance, blackjack involves making strategic decisions based on the player’s hand and the dealer’s upcard. Effective strategies, like basic strategy charts, provide players with statistically optimal decisions for every possible scenario. Mastering basic strategy dramatically reduces the house edge, giving players a better chance of winning. More advanced techniques, such as card counting, aim to track the ratio of high to low cards remaining in the deck, providing an even greater advantage. The accessibility of blackjack and the potential for strategic play have made it a perennially popular choice amongst casino-goers.

The modern evolution of blackjack has also resulted in variations on the classic game, such as Spanish 21 and Blackjack Switch. These variants introduce additional rules and side bets, adding complexity and excitement. The underlying principle remains the same however: to come as close to 21 as possible without exceeding it, while outplaying the dealer.
